Wijngoed Fromberg in Voerendaal

Marcel and Carmen Boomers founded Fromberg Winery in Voerendaal in early 1991. With passion and dedication, they have been cultivating juicy grapes on Dutch soil for many years, which they process artisanally into sun-drenched wines and refined sparkling wines.

Experimentation is in their nature. They consider it important to work without traditional pesticides. For example, to combat the Suzuki fly, they use liquid silicon. A thin layer is applied like a silver lining around the grape, making it difficult for the fly to penetrate this protective coating.

Although the Romans did not use silicon in the modern chemical sense, they did make use of natural sources of silicon such as ash, sand, and certain types of clay, which could strengthen plants.

We feel fortunate to be able to work in this beautiful place in Voerendaal, overlooking the rolling South Limburg landscape, where our grapes can fully enjoy the radiant sun.

The Romans are also inseparably linked to the history of Voerendaal. After all, the largest Roman villa in the Netherlands was excavated here. The discovery of the head of Lady Furenthela – or Lady Voerendaal – still captures the imagination.

The Roman past has therefore been a wonderful source of inspiration for us.
